Summary:

The city of Fosston, Minnesota is home to two public schools: Magelssen Elementary and Fosston Secondary. These schools serve students from pre-kindergarten through 12th grade and are part of the Fosston Public School District.

Fosston Secondary stands out as the top-performing school in the area, ranking in the top 25% of Minnesota high schools. It boasts a strong 84.2% four-year graduation rate, a low 4.4% dropout rate, and proficiency rates in math and reading that exceed the state averages. In contrast, Magelssen Elementary has seen some fluctuations in its rankings but consistently outperforms the state in academic proficiency.

Overall, the Fosston Public School District is ranked 91 out of 446 districts in Minnesota and has a 4-star rating, indicating the district as a whole is performing well above average. While the schools serve a community with over 50% of students qualifying for free or reduced-price lunch, they are still able to deliver strong academic outcomes, making them an attractive option for families in the Fosston area.
